How to Make Fresh Berry Cream Tart
Now that you have all your ingredients ready, let’s dive into the fun part: making your Fresh Berry Cream Tart!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a stunning dessert that’s sure to impress.
Step 1: Prepare the Crust
Start by mixing the gra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and sugar in a bowl. The mixture should resemble wet sand. Press this mixture firmly into the bottom and up the sides of your tart pan. If you want a firmer crust, you can bake it at 350°F for about 8 minutes. Otherwise, just chill it in the fridge for 10 minutes. Trust me, a chilled crust is a delight!
Step 2: Make the Cream Filling
In a m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ese, sugar, vanilla extract, and lemon zest until it’s smooth and creamy. This is where the magic begins! The lemon zest adds a refreshing zing that balances the sweetness. Make sure there are no lumps; we want a silky filling!
Step 3: Combine the Mixtures
In a separate bowl, whip the heavy cream until soft peaks form. This step is crucial for that light, airy texture. Gently fold the whipped cream into the cream cheese mixture. Be careful not to deflate the whipped cream; we want to keep that fluffiness intact. This combination is what makes the filling so dreamy!
Step 4: Assemble the Tart
Spread the creamy filling evenly into your cooled crust. Use a spatula to smooth it out. Now comes the fun part—arranging the fresh berries! Place them in clusters on top of the filling, creating a colorful and inviting display. You can be as creative as you like; it’s your tart!
Step 5: Chill and Garnish
Once your tart is assembled, pop it in the fridge for at least an hour. This chilling time allows the flavors to meld beautifully. If you want to add a touch of shine, lightly brush the berries with warmed jam before serving. Finally, garnish with fresh mint leaves for that extra pop of color. Variations of Fresh Berry Cream Tart
- Gluten-Free Option: Substitute graham cracker crumbs with gluten-free cookie crumbs or almond flour for a delicious gluten-free crust.
- Vegan Twist: Use vegan cream cheese and coconut cream instead of heavy cream for a plant-based version that’s just as creamy.
- Chocolate Lovers: Add cocoa powder to the cream filling for a chocolatey delight, or drizzle melted chocolate over the berries for an indulgent touch.
- Fruit Variations: Swap out the berries for other fruits like peaches, mangoes, or kiwi for a tropical flair.
- Nutty Crust: Mix in crushed nuts like pecans or walnuts with the graham cracker crumbs for added texture and flavor.

FAQs about Fresh Berry Cream Tart
Can I make the Fresh Berry Cream Tart 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the tart a day in advance. Just keep it covered in the fridge. This allows the flavors to meld beautifully, making it even more delicious!
What can I substitute for heavy cream in the filling?
If you’re looking for a lighter option, you can use whipped coconut cream or a non-dairy whipped topping. Both will give you a lovely texture without the heaviness of heavy cream.
How do I store leftovers of the Fresh Berry Cream Tart?
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ge. It’s best enjoyed within 2-3 days for optimal freshness. Just be sure to keep it chilled!
Can I use frozen berries instead of fresh?
While fresh berries are ideal for this Fresh Berry Cream Tart, you can use frozen berries in a pinch. Just thaw and drain them well to avoid excess moisture in your tart.

Fresh Berry Cream Tart: Simple Recipe for Delight!
- Total Time: 1 hour 20 minutes (including chill time)
- Yield: 1 tart (8–10 slices) 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
A crisp graham crust filled with silky cream and piled high with juicy fresh berries.
Ingredients
- Fresh mixed berries (strawberries, raspberries, blueberries, blackberries)
- 1 1/2 cups graham cracker crumbs
- 8 oz cream cheese
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1/4 cup butter, melted
- 1/4 cup sugar
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 tsp lemon zest
- Fresh mint (optional garnish)
Instructions
- Mix graham crumbs, melted butter, and sugar, then press firmly into a tart pan; chill for 10 minutes (or bake for 8 minutes at 350°F for a crisp crust).
- Beat cream cheese, sugar, vanilla, and lemon zest until smooth.
- Whip heavy cream separately to soft peaks, then fold into the cream cheese mixture to create a fluffy filling.
- Spread filling evenly in the cooled crust.
- Arrange fresh berries in clusters for a vibrant layered look.
- Lightly brush berries with a touch of warmed jam if you want extra shine (optional).
- Chill for 1 hour before slicing; garnish with mint.
